首先,庆祝下个人网站开通喽!!!为了纪念下,总该写点什么来着,那让我就来写写本站从零到转移到虚拟云主机上的一些过程琐事吧。
开通个人站的想法从很久之前就有这个打算,可以追溯到大学时期。那时候有大把大把的自由时间来支配,即使如此,结果还是没有搭建起来 ┑( ̄Д  ̄)┍。现在出来工作几年了,也都是从事技术相关工作,每次找资料都能搜索到大牛们的技术分享,感觉自己就是个假“程序员”。所以就决定自己开个站点,向大牛们学习,写写工作生活上琐事,分享、交流下技术,记录下生活的轨迹,这也是初衷! 当然,可以使用CSDN、博客园、知乎那些提供的平台,不过也是都有一定局限,还有谁叫我是喜欢折腾的人,哇咔咔 ~Better late than never!
从决定到基本完成,准备了几个礼拜时间,先是决定使用哪个CMS作为平台,从wordpress、mediawiki、zblog中选择。一开始使用WAMP在本地快速搭建测试环境,决定先安装部署wordpress并测试,wordpress的确功能强大、界面也华丽、使用管理也很方便,而且有很多资料。使用测试了几天,发现页面打开速度的确慢了点,查找资料都说是加载了谷歌字体等国外资源等等,对国内来说需要优化,于是装了Google Font Fix、Cache插件后,速度变得快多了。后面找来另一个程序zblog,这个国内团队开发的,进行对比。Zblog打开速度确实快多了,而且对比了下wordpress的后台,会更加简洁,配置也简单。里面也有很多插件扩展,虽然没有wordpress功能强大,作为一个CMS也是够了。
对于mediawiki这个平台,最初是从公司内部部署的wiki知识系统接触到。mediawiki是一个百科词条协作系统,用于个人的知识整理归档以及企业的知识归档,而且mediawiki被作为维基百科全书的系统软件,以前只知道在Wikipedia找资料,都不知道它使用的平台。刚好现在自己也有这个需求,想把放在云笔记上的零散知识碎片、计算机内不知道存哪里的资料文档,好多材料进行系统化的归纳整理! 有这个决定后,接下来的大部分时间就开始在本地搭建、配置mediawiki,并在本地尝试整理了若干词条。Mediawiki的功能非常强大,可定制性强,要把它配置到符合自己使用习惯,花了好大精力。首先研究它的编辑器语法,如:字体颜色、大小、画表格、字符格式化、模板使用等等。然后安装一些常见插件,包括文件上传扩展,字符高亮、PDF导出等常用的插件,特别是页面PDF导出,很多PDF插件对中文支持都不好。测试了下,达到了自己的预期,界面简洁、是个很好的知识归档CMS。实际使用了3个平台,各有各自的优点。个人比较偏向喜欢mediawiki,然后是wordpress,其次zblog。使用Mediawiki写作上,让人看起来更加严谨,类似学术词典一样,也可以多人一起维护,而且让人感觉高大上,哈哈。
最后平台本地调试都完成后,后面就是到阿里万网上购买域名和主机。主机目前使用的是阿里虚拟云主机,便宜、操作简单,而没有选择ECS服务器。考虑到个人站点性质,非盈利的,对配置要求也不高,也不知道自己能坚持维护这个站点到什么时候(☆▽☆)。选好域名、买好主机、上传代码到主机空间,才发现主机是基于 Windows server 2008 IIS的服务器,而且不支持PHP语言,所以Meidiawiki是没法用了,Wordpress、Z-blog的php版本也没法用了。最后只能使用很久之前出的Z-blog ASP 2.2版本~~~~(>_<)~~~~,使用它最为CMS平台也是够用了,主要还是进行创作分享。至于MediaWiki就先作为本地的知识仓库来使用,等有条件、有时间,再单独部署或者和wordpress一起整合部署到服务器上!
搭建过程的废话就写到这了,文笔逻辑不好请见谅,仅此作为开站序章!
